According the center for disease control if you are exercising at a moderate intensity level you will be able to do which of the
KIM [24]

Answer: b. Carry on a conversation

Explanation:

There are different levels of intensity when exercising and these require different energy levels and different amounts of air coming into the lungs.

The CDC notes that if you are exercising at a moderate level, the energy and oxygen requirements will not be as high so you can be able to talk to other people without being short of breath from needing more of the oxygen and energy that is being used in the talking.
